/*!
  \class SbDPViewVolume SbLinear.h Inventor/SbLinear.h
  \brief The SbDPViewVolume class is a double precision viewing volume in 3D space.
  \ingroup base

  This class contains the necessary information for storing a view
  volume.  It has methods for projection of primitives from or into
  the 3D volume, doing camera transforms, view volume transforms etc.

  \COIN_CLASS_EXTENSION

  \sa SbViewportRegion
  \since Coin 2.0
*/

// Orthographic projection matrix. From the "OpenGL Programming Guide,
// release 1", Appendix G (but with row-major mode).
static SbDPMatrix
get_perspective_projection(const double rightminusleft, const double rightplusleft,
                           const double topminusbottom, const double topplusbottom,
                           const double nearval, const double farval)
{
  SbDPMatrix proj;

  proj[0][0] = 2.0*nearval/rightminusleft;
  proj[0][1] = 0.0;
  proj[0][2] = 0.0;
  proj[0][3] = 0.0;
  proj[1][0] = 0.0;
  proj[1][1] = 2.0*nearval/topminusbottom;
  proj[1][2] = 0.0;
  proj[1][3] = 0.0;
  proj[2][0] = rightplusleft/rightminusleft;
  proj[2][1] = topplusbottom/topminusbottom;
  proj[2][2] = -(farval+nearval)/(farval-nearval);
  proj[2][3] = -1.0;
  proj[3][0] = 0.0;
  proj[3][1] = 0.0;
  proj[3][2] = -2.0*farval*nearval/(farval-nearval);
  proj[3][3] = 0.0;

  return proj;
}


// Perspective projection matrix. From the "OpenGL Programming Guide,
// release 1", Appendix G (but with row-major mode).
static SbDPMatrix
get_ortho_projection(const double rightminusleft, const double rightplusleft,
                     const double topminusbottom, const double topplusbottom,
                     const double nearval, const double farval)
{
  SbDPMatrix proj;
  proj[0][0] = 2.0/rightminusleft;
  proj[0][1] = 0.0;
  proj[0][2] = 0.0;
  proj[0][3] = 0.0;
  proj[1][0] = 0.0;
  proj[1][1] = 2.0/topminusbottom;
  proj[1][2] = 0.0;
  proj[1][3] = 0.0;
  proj[2][0] = 0.0;
  proj[2][1] = 0.0;
  proj[2][2] = -2.0/(farval-nearval);
  proj[2][3] = 0.0;
  proj[3][0] = -rightplusleft/rightminusleft;
  proj[3][1] = -topplusbottom/topminusbottom;
  proj[3][2] = -(farval+nearval)/(farval-nearval);
  proj[3][3] = 1.0;

  return proj;

}

/*!
  Project the \a src point to a normalized set of screen coordinates in
  the projection plane and place the result in \a dst.

  It is safe to let \a src and \dst be the same SbVec3d instance.
  
  The z-coordinate of \a dst is monotonically increasing for points
  closer to the far plane. Note however that this is not a linear
  relationship, the \a dst z-coordinate is calculated as follows:
  
  Orthogonal view:  DSTz = (-2 * SRCz - far - near) / (far - near),
  Perspective view:  DSTz = (-SRCz * (far - near) - 2*far*near) / (far - near)

  The returned coordinates (\a dst) are normalized to be in range [0, 1].
*/
void
SbDPViewVolume::projectToScreen(const SbVec3d& src, SbVec3d& dst) const
{
  this->getMatrix().multVecMatrix(src, dst);
  
  // coordinates are in range [-1, 1], normalize to [0,1]
  dst *= 0.5f;
  dst += SbVec3d(0.5f, 0.5f, 0.5f);
}

/*!
  Set up the view volume as a rectangular box for orthographic
  parallel projections. The line of sight will be along the negative
  z axis, through the center of the plane defined by the point
  <(right+left)/2, (top+bottom)/2, 0>.

  \sa perspective().
*/
void
SbDPViewVolume::ortho(double left, double right,
                    double bottom, double top,
                    double nearval, double farval)
{
#if defined(COIN_DEBUG) && 0 // disabled 2002-08-30 pederb

  // These parameter tests are probably incorrect. It is possible to
  // set left > right etc. in SGI/TGS Inventor, and it should be
  // possible to do this in Coin also.  pederb.

  // (Yes, we've actually had user requests for making this possible
  // after first disallowing it. I don't know what kind of effects
  // they are using this for, and I'm not sure I want to know.. :-})
  // mortene.


  if (left>right)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::ortho",
                              "right coordinate (%f) should be larger than "
                              "left coordinate (%f). Swapping left/right.",
                              right,left);
    double tmp=right;
    right=left;
    left=tmp;
  }
  if (bottom>top)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::ortho",
                              "top coordinate (%f) should be larger than "
                              "bottom coordinate (%f). Swapping bottom/top.",
                              top,bottom);
    double tmp=top;
    top=bottom;
    bottom=tmp;
  }
  if (nearval>farval)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::ortho",
                              "far coordinate (%f) should be larger than near "
                              "coordinate (%f). Swapping near/far.",farval,nearval);
    double tmp=farval;
    farval=nearval;
    nearval=tmp;
  }
#endif // disabled

  this->type = SbDPViewVolume::ORTHOGRAPHIC;
  this->projPoint.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, 0.0f);
  this->projDir.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, -1.0f);
  this->nearDist = nearval;
  this->nearToFar = farval - nearval;
  this->llf.setValue(left, bottom, -nearval);
  this->lrf.setValue(right, bottom, -nearval);
  this->ulf.setValue(left, top, -nearval);
}

// FIXME: bitmap-illustration for function doc which shows how the
// frustum is set up wrt the input arguments. 20010919 mortene.
/*!
  Set up the view volume for perspective projections. The line of
  sight will be through origo along the negative z axis.

  \sa ortho().
*/
void
SbDPViewVolume::perspective(double fovy, double aspect,
                            double nearval, double farval)
{
#if COIN_DEBUG
  if (fovy<0.0f || fovy > M_PI)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::perspective",
                              "Field of View 'fovy' (%f) is out of bounds "
                              "[0,PI]. Clamping to be within bounds.",fovy);
    if (fovy<0.0f) fovy=0.0f;
    else if (fovy>M_PI) fovy=M_PI;
  }

#if 0 // obsoleted 2003-02-03 pederb. A negative aspect ratio is ok
  if (aspect<0.0f)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::perspective",
                              "Aspect ratio 'aspect' (%d) should be >=0.0f. "
                              "Clamping to 0.0f.",aspect);
    aspect=0.0f;
  }
#endif // obsoleted

  if (nearval>farval) {
    SoDebugError::postWarning("SbDPViewVolume::perspective",
                              "far coordinate (%f) should be larger than "
                              "near coordinate (%f). Swapping near/far.",
                              farval,nearval);
    double tmp=farval;
    farval=nearval;
    nearval=tmp;
  }
#endif // COIN_DEBUG

  this->type = SbDPViewVolume::PERSPECTIVE;
  this->projPoint.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, 0.0f);
  this->projDir.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, -1.0f);
  this->nearDist = nearval;
  this->nearToFar = farval - nearval;

  double top = nearval * double(tan(fovy/2.0f));
  double bottom = -top;
  double left = bottom * aspect;
  double right = -left;

  this->llf.setValue(left, bottom, -nearval);
  this->lrf.setValue(right, bottom, -nearval);
  this->ulf.setValue(left, top, -nearval);
}

/*! 
  Set up the frustum for perspective projection. This is an
  alternative to perspective() that lets you specify any kind of view
  volumes (e.g. off center volumes). It has the same arguments and
  functionality as the corresponding OpenGL glFrustum() function.

  \sa perspective() 
*/
void 
SbDPViewVolume::frustum(double left, double right,
                        double bottom, double top,
                        double nearval, double farval)
{
  this->type = SbDPViewVolume::PERSPECTIVE;
  this->projPoint.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, 0.0f);
  this->projDir.setValue(0.0f, 0.0f, -1.0f);
  this->nearDist = nearval;
  this->nearToFar = farval - nearval;

  this->llf.setValue(left, bottom, -nearval);
  this->lrf.setValue(right, bottom, -nearval);
  this->ulf.setValue(left, top, -nearval);
}
